How We Remove Water from Your Roof and Property

When dealing with a roof leak, it’s crucial to have a clear understanding of the restoration process. Our team’s process is designed to be efficient, effective, and hassle-free, ensuring that your property is restored to its original state as quickly as possible.

Step 1: Emergency Response and Assessment

We’ll respond to your emergency call within 60 minutes and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age to identify the cause of the roof leak and the extent of the water dam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Our team will use specialized equipment, such as wet/dry vacuum trucks and dehumidifiers, to extract the water and dry your property, ensuring that the area is completely dry and safe for any further work.

Step 3: Structural Drying and Cleaning

We’ll use advanced equ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and air scrubbers, to dry out the structural elements of your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ings, and clean any affected areas to prevent mold and bacteria growth.

Step 4: Reconstruction and Repair

Once the property is dry and clean, we’ll work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ials, including roofing, walls, and flooring, to ensure that your property is restored to its original state.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that the restoration is complete and meets our high standards, making any necessary touch-ups to ensure that your property is safe and secure.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Taylorsville, NC

The cost of roof le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Taylorsville, NC. Our team will provide a free estimate to assess the damage and find out the best course of action.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ted
Structural Drying and Cleaning $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 Complexity of the job and amount of work required
